fix(aula-12): permitir node-exporter com PodSecurity privileged
O namespace monitoring precisa de enforce=privileged para o prometheus-node-exporter que usa hostNetwork, hostPID e hostPath.
This commit is contained in:
@@ -180,6 +180,7 @@ helm repo add vm https://victoriametrics.github.io/helm-charts/ 2>/dev/null || t
|
|||||||
helm repo update vm
|
helm repo update vm
|
||||||
|
|
||||||
kubectl create namespace monitoring 2>/dev/null || true
|
kubectl create namespace monitoring 2>/dev/null || true
|
||||||
|
kubectl label namespace monitoring pod-security.kubernetes.io/enforce=privileged --overwrite
|
||||||
|
|
||||||
if helm status monitoring -n monitoring &> /dev/null; then
|
if helm status monitoring -n monitoring &> /dev/null; then
|
||||||
log_warn "Já instalado. Atualizando..."
|
log_warn "Já instalado. Atualizando..."
|
||||||
|
|||||||
Reference in New Issue
Block a user